zoukankan      html  css  js  c++  java
  • 硬件设计节约成本经验笔记

    硬件设计节约成本经验笔记

    1、这些拉高拉低的电阻用多大的阻值关系不大,就选个整数5K吧

    市场上不存在5K的阻值,最接近的是 4.99K(精度1%),其次是5.1K(精度5%),其成本分别比精度为20%的4.7K高4倍和2倍。20%精度的电阻阻值只有1、1.5、2.2、 3.3、4.7、6.8几个类别(含10的整数倍);类似地,20%精度的电容也只有以上几种值,如果选了其它的值就必须使用更高的精度,成本就翻了几倍,却不能带来任何好处。

     

    2、面板上的指示灯选什么颜色呢?我觉得蓝色比较特别,就选它吧

    其它红绿黄橙等颜色的不管大小(5MM以下)封装如何,都已成熟了几十年,价格一般都在5毛钱以下,而蓝色却是近三四年才发明的东西,技术成熟度和供货稳定度都较差,价格却要贵四五倍。目前蓝色指示灯只用在不能用其它颜色替代的场合,如显示视频信号等。

     

    3、这点逻辑用74XX的门电路搭也行,但太土,还是用CPLD吧,显得高档多了

    74XX的门电路只几毛钱,而CPLD至少也得几十块,(GALPAL虽然只几块钱,但公司不推荐使用)。成本提高了N倍不说,还给生产、文档等工作增添数倍的工作。

     

    4、我们的系统要求这么高,包括MEM、CPU、FPGA等所有的芯片都要选最快的

    在一个高速系统中并不是每一部分都工作在高速状态,而器件速度每提高一个等级,价格差不多要翻倍,另外还给信号完整性问题带来极大的负面影响。

     

    5、这板子的PCB设计要求不高,就用细一点的线,自动布吧

    自动布线必然要占用更大的PCB面积,同时产生比手动布线多好多倍的过孔,在批量很大的产品中,PCB厂家降价所考虑的因素除了商务因素外,就是线宽和过孔数量,它们分别影响到PCB的成品率和钻头的消耗数量,节约了供应商的成本,也就给降价找到了理由。

     

    6、程序只要稳定就可以了,代码长一点,效率低一点不是关键

    CPU的速度和存储器的空间都是用钱买来的,如果写代码时多花几天时间提高一下程序效率,那么从降低CPU主频和减少存储器容量所节约的成本绝对是划算的。CPLD、FPGA设计也类似。

     

     

     

    ^_^Bruce Lone

    2015-9-10

  • 相关阅读:
    Linux 线程间通信方式+进程通信方式 总结
    使用opencv第三方库的makefile文件示例
    rplidar SDK 二次开发---之获取目标信息(0.1)
    #include "Target_orientation.h"
    opencv —— 调用摄像头采集图像 VideoCapture capture(0);
    cmake 支持-lpthread
    ROS下sensor_msgs::ImagePtr到sensor_msgs::Image之间的转换
    JAVA 校验身份证号码工具类(支持15位和18位)
    python面向对象游戏练习:好人坏人手枪手榴弹
    python 私有属性的作用
  • 原文地址:https://www.cnblogs.com/BruceLone/p/4798566.html
Copyright © 2011-2022 走看看